Output d50efe61da30cb55f69a9be31d8bcb627918587645f4c7d326ffeabd2a6204c7: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b929cf3e18e3fe9b7fd1938734eb4d636326671c OP_EQUAL
address
3Ja521Yh3qAQaYXJWCtzNDboJaXmrDiRTA
transaction
d50efe61da30cb55f69a9be31d8bcb627918587645f4c7d326ffeabd2a6204c7